There is a sadness, or a strange sense of melancholy, to Enright's writing that is difficult to describe - yet so poignant, somehow. Each of her sentences drives itself home, precise in a way very few things are. I very much admire this quality; even though I felt I knew what the story was like, or where it was going, it still managed to make me so emotional that I find myself having a hard time placing the book on its shelf.
